#68fedf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68fedf is composed of 40.8% red, 99.6% green and 87.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 12.2%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 167.6 degrees, a saturation of 98.7% and a lightness of 70.2%. #68fedf color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ffff with #00fdbf.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#68fedf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#68fedf has RGB values of R:104, G:254, B:223 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0. Its decimal value is 6880991.
